-- test/test-clod.lua
--
-- Configuration languge organised (by) dots.
--
-- Copyright 2012 Daniel Silverstone <dsilvers@digital-scurf.org>
--
-- For Licence terms, see COPYING
--
-- Step one, start coverage
local luacov = require 'luacov'
local clod = require 'clod'
local testnames = {}
local real_assert = assert
local total_asserts = 0
local function assert(...)
local retval = real_assert(...)
total_asserts = total_asserts + 1
return retval
end
local function add_test(suite, name, value)
rawset(suite, name, value)
testnames[#testnames+1] = name
end
local suite = setmetatable({}, {__newindex = add_test})
function suite.test_parse_empty()
local conf = assert(clod.parse(""))
end
local count_ok = 0
for _, testname in ipairs(testnames) do
-- print("Run: " .. testname)
local ok, err = xpcall(suite[testname], debug.traceback)
if not ok then
print(err)
print()
else
count_ok = count_ok + 1
end
end
print(tostring(count_ok) .. "/" .. tostring(#testnames) .. " [" .. tostring(total_asserts) .. "] OK")
os.exit(count_ok == #testnames and 0 or 1)
